Maine Stories
Maine Stories celebrates a landscape tradition which has captivated generations of artists for over 100 years, from Thomas Cole and Frederick Church to Winslow Homer and Andrew Wyeth, and many more. A vital place of artistic inspiration, Maine's alluring wild beauty, rugged coastline, churning seas, iconic lighthouses, vivid buoys, lobster boats and twilit harbors have been subjects for some of America’s finest painters.
